Output c64866d2382d072a3ca6cd244e13f3771797cdb7ee0c1645d12ce0e575846a66:1

value
18005041
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 901c1fd744d386855c46e011e56bd50b8b4aacc4 OP_EQUALVERIFY OP_CHECKSIG
address
1E8yzjuCmGK1H3mspK4mQiL8vGBWENpeoJ
transaction
c64866d2382d072a3ca6cd244e13f3771797cdb7ee0c1645d12ce0e575846a66
confirmations
533036
spent
true